
Eternal
Literal Infinity
Use 'eternal' to describe something that truly has no end, not just something that lasts a long time.

Their love was eternal.
Poetic Emphasis
'Eternal' can add dramatic effect in poetry or romantic contexts, highlighting limitless time.

He gazed into the stars, yearning for eternal peace.
Exaggeration Caution
Avoid using 'eternal' for exaggerating temporary situations; it's often too strong.

Waiting an hour isn't 'an eternal delay.'
